Transaction 392381500dc23e71d5071443bd33326c9a0428b50b4290902e8d4e79a5b3f84f

81 Input
2 Outputs
  • 392381500dc23e71d5071443bd33326c9a0428b50b4290902e8d4e79a5b3f84f:0
  • value  631487
    address  35RQRwvt9B32mZjohAgCzBmPjLZg2EY7iZ
  • 392381500dc23e71d5071443bd33326c9a0428b50b4290902e8d4e79a5b3f84f:1
  • value  1168902948
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s